Abstract

By means of the effective mass approximation we have computed without any adjustable parameters the energy levels and hyperfine splitting of a P impurity in silicon spherical nanocrystals as a function of the nanocrystal radius. Confinement effects produce an enhancement of the energy levels and of the hyperfine splitting as the crystal radius is decreased. Our results are in good agreement with available experimental data.
